The Allure of Tweed: Texture and Finish
The defining characteristic of the Dior Tweed eyeshadow is, unsurprisingly, its texture. The brand masterfully replicates the intricate weave of tweed fabric, resulting in a multi-dimensional eyeshadow with a subtle, almost imperceptible shimmer. It's not a chunky glitter or a heavily frosted finish; instead, it offers a refined luminosity that catches the light beautifully without being overly distracting. This unique texture contributes to the eyeshadow's versatility. It can be applied sheerly for a delicate wash of color, or built up for a more intense, yet still refined, look. The texture itself feels incredibly smooth and buttery, almost creamy upon application, blending effortlessly onto the eyelids without any noticeable tugging or pulling. This makes it particularly user-friendly, even for those less experienced with eyeshadow application.
Unlike some matte eyeshadows that can appear dry or powdery, the Dior Tweed eyeshadow maintains a soft, almost velvety feel throughout the day. This contributes to its impressive longevity; it doesn't crease or fade easily, ensuring a flawless look for hours. The color payoff is excellent, even with a light hand, allowing for precise control over the intensity of the shade. This makes it suitable for both subtle daytime looks and bolder evening makeup.
Color Range and Versatility
While the exact shade range of Dior Tweed eyeshadows may vary across seasons and availability, the core concept remains consistent: offering a selection of sophisticated and wearable shades. The colors generally lean towards neutrals, with variations in tone and undertones to cater to different skin tones and preferences. You'll find shades ranging from warm, earthy browns to cool-toned greys and taupes, along with occasional pops of color that seamlessly integrate into the overall neutral palette.
This versatility is key to the Dior Tweed eyeshadow’s appeal. The shades are easily mixable and matchable, allowing for countless combinations and looks. A single shade can be worn on its own for a simple yet elegant look, or multiple shades can be blended together to create more complex and dramatic eye makeup. This adaptability makes it a valuable addition to any makeup collection, regardless of skill level or preferred style.
